Jason Fung, MD
Dr. Fung is a Toronto based kidney specialist, having graduated from the University of Toronto and finishing his medical specialty at the University of California, Los Angeles in 2001. His bestselling book, The Obesity Code has now been released in more than eight languages, with rights recently sold in Arabic.
